@Jennifer464 yes, you should get CS to cancel her... NO you will not get paid for her stay.

The cancellation policy no longer applies when you ask to enforce rules.

You aren't comfortable, she shouldn't stay in your house, that is you dodging a bullet, but no, you won't get any money. Hurry up and do it before it is within 24 hours of her checkin time, bc if you get to that time the she will also be allowed to review you

@Jennifer464if you can get guests without instant booking option on Airbnb then great, but you have to be very careful who you accept because you will not have 3 free cancelation/year because you feel uncomfortable, this option is for instant bookings only.

I hate instant  book because of this and always meet my guests Or get someone to a few hours after arrival or next day to check on them 

Take away sheets towels pillows for extras if you are suss about how many people also
